Hello, I am struggling to find spark plug caps for my bike.
I am wondering if electrical parts that fit older GS400's will fit and work on mine.
I am aware that my bike is called a GSX400E in the rest of the world. If parts that fit lets say an early 80's GS400/GS450 (2 valves per cyl) fit, then I would appreciate where I could go.
I tried looking on NGK for plugs that would fit.

Also a side note, I just bought new plugs, NGK Iridium IX (BR8EIX). The shop I used is Fortnine in Canada, the only bike I could find that was listed was an 86 GS450 L. The site says the plugs fit that bike, so I am assuming it will fit mine.
Am I correct?
 
The catalogues for plugs and caps are not so hard to find online.

NGK Iridium IX (BR8EIX) is in the catalogue as suitable for GSX400 It replaces D8EA, DR8ES-L so you should be fine.

Caps? I don't have the time right now I would get the ones that match your bike's old ones as to angle....
If you get straight ones, you may or may not have difficulty because of the length of the plugwire....IE: bending the old wires too much

In Spark plugs, many of the other Suzuki bikes of our era use the same plug...and come to that so does my Honda

The BR8EIX is one I would like to try myself so report back...I know the irridium plugs are good in my car!
 
Last edited:
Be careful. NGK B series plugs are 14mm thread. D series are 12mm.
The original GS400 uses 14mm plugs - the later GSX400 uses 12mm.

Another instance I think of the poor marketing decision to call all the family GS within the US. So much clearer when the 4V/cyl engines are GSX...
 
Hey-thats right! DR8EIX is in the 2017 catalogue

Well,HammerHT has already bought the plugs ...I've heard Fortnine has a pretty good return policy.
 
Indeed, I bought a pair myself lately (DR8EIX) and these fit the 81 gsx400 twins I have.... Pricey, not required, but hey, candy for my baby. They deserve a treat every so often.
